How Can A Slab Leak Occur

Older pipes tend to wear out over time. The slow breakdown of plumbing is a major cause of slab leaks. Leaks often occur in hot water pipes. The heat from the pipes can react with the surrounding soil and accelerate the corrosion rate too.

Slab leaks can occur due to the construction or maintenance work at a nearby house. Movement on the ground can cause pipe damage. So watch out for slab leaks if there is a new building around your house. Seismic movement and soil erosion could also lead to events increasing pressure on the slab pipes and cause leaks

Whatever the causes, even the smallest leak can lead to a lot of water wastage and a huge water bill.

Signs You Need to Watch Out

How do you know if you have a slab in your home? There are several ways to identify leaks:

Increase In Your Water Bill – A very easy way to find out if you may have a slab leak is if your water bill has increased significantly in a short period of time. If you can’t see any type of leak above the ground, your water costs will most likely be affected by a slab leak.

Water marks – One of the easiest ways to find leaks is to find a water mark or wet mark on your floor. They are usually triggered by a leaking hot water pipe. Not only can you notice or feel these places when walking barefoot, but you can also hear the water sounds under the floor.

Swelling – If your system is leaking, it will be more difficult to see the real leak. This is because leaks from drains usually do not have signs of damage to the substrate. However, places with a lot of dirt can be affected by changes in height, which can cause your slab to swell. Inspect the affected floor area for possible leaks.

Sound – If there are no visible water marks or swelling, the only way to detect slab leaks is to use the special detection system. This involves a process in which the experts in slab leak detection in Orange County will turn off the water to your home and pump air into the pipe. The plumber then uses a special tool to hear the sound made when air leaks from the pipe.

What Type Of Damage Can Slab Leaks Cause?

If you don’t discover leaking pipes at the right time, or if you don’t fix the problem as soon as possible, a slab leak can cause huge and costly damages to your home. The following are some of the problems that can arise from a slab leak.

Broken Floors – The longer water flows through leaks of your home, the more the risk of damage to your floors. A leaking floor can result in broken tiles and saturated floors.

Cracks in the Foundation – If there are multiple leak points and water seeps into the concrete, over time, there could be minor cracks depending on other factors associated with the slab leaks.

Damage to Yard – Leaks, in certain instances, can get onto your garden. This can result in events where you would need to repair fixtures or equipment in the yard, which has suffered water damage. Such leaks can also affect outdoor swimming pools.

Odor – Leaks, when not repaired, will eventually cause stains and odors, which will spread throughout your home. The work kind of underground leaks could be from drain pipes.

Mold – Slab leaks can spread directly to the wall from the floor, and since the wall has a tendency to absorb water, mold will inevitably start to grow. Apart from being unattractive, mold can cause health problems to your family members, especially those dealing with respiratory problems.

How Much Damage Can it Cause?

Damage repair and costs depend on how long the leak has remained undetected and what kind of havoc it has created. Has it created low water pressure affecting certain appliances, or has the leak slowly spread across basement areas leading to mold and mildew?

Pinhole leaks can be minute if you are only looking at the size of the pipe leak. But where the slab pipe is exactly located determines how it can be repaired. If you have a pinhole slab leak under a complex bathroom plumbing system, for example, would you consider removing it and digging through? Most probably not. In such cases, slap pipe rerouting is sometimes the best solution.
